Zuidplaspolder

A combination of greenhouses, homes, water storage and ecology. The houses are clustered on higher ground and are connected by raised infrastructure. The areas in between can be used as additional space for water storage. During so-called ‘Westlandbuien’ (storms in the Westland region), these areas can flood without their functioning, safety and liveability being adversely affected. In emergencies, the lower areas in the residential strips can also temporarily buffer part of the emergency discharge from the greenhouse areas.
